Sealy has been a leading mattress company for decades and its founding goes back to 1881 in – you guessed it - Sealy, Texas. It’s now part of Tempur-Sealy Intl., the largest mattress maker in the world. Sealy mattress prices span from the mid to upper-end.
Sealy is a broad-ranging mattress manufacturer, so they make all kinds of mattresses including innerspring, all-foam, and hybrid (innerspring/foam combo) mattresses. Sealy has a range of collections to suit different needs and price points. Each collection also has a variety of price points within it. If a model includes "Posturepedic" in the name, that means it has added back support in the center third of the mattress with Posturepedic Technologyâ„¢.

The Posturepedic Hybrid collection demonstrates how Sealy has excelled at hybrid mattresses. They're very focused on developing the newest, most cutting-edge sleep technology. The hybrids combine the support of their innerspring coil designs with an advanced foam layer. This is how the mattress offers both the reactive feel of an innerspring support system and the contouring feel of memory foam mattresses. These mattresses are reliable for side sleepers and back sleepers. If you're considering a hybrid mattress, you should 100% check out the models from Sealy.

The Posturepedic Plus line of innerspring mattresses with Posturepedic Technology is a premium collection from Sealy, meant to provide great support to the lower back. They use high-quality foams and an encased coil system with zoning (most support in the center third). For anyone who's experienced back pain after sleeping and needs pressure relief, these would be a good option to check out.

There are three adjustable base models for Tempur-Sealy. Adjustable bases (also called Power Bases) give you more options for using a mattress. From sitting in bed to reading or sleeping with your head or legs up, etc. Some even have added features like a massage function. There are three models available with Sealy mattresses:

Sealy mattresses are available in select stores or online, but not directly from Sealy. They are usually delivered by a retailer’s in-home delivery service. In-home delivery is typically offered for free, along with the removal of an old existing mattress.
Sealy mattresses always provide a 10-year warranty against manufacturer's defects. your new mattress will also come with a 120-day trial period to make sure that your premium mattress lasts a long time and provides a good night's sleep.
Sealy is one of the oldest and largest mattress brands in America. The Posturepedic mattresses and blue butterfly logo are what Sealy is known for. A few years ago, Tempur-Pedic purchased Sealy, along with its sister brand, Stearns & Foster. The company is now Tempur-Sealy and is the largest mattress company in the world.
Sealy continues to make a wide range of mattresses. Entry-level mattresses cost a few hundred dollars, and they go all the way up to mattresses priced at a couple thousand. There are tens of millions of Sealy mattresses in use today. They've maintained their status as some of the most popular beds in America.
